What do Australian risk management consultants do?
Risk management consultants assess potential risks that could impact a business and design practical strategies to minimise or control them. In Australia, this often includes compliance with national standards, industry regulations, and insurance requirements.
Typical services include:
- Conducting detailed risk assessments across operations
- Identifying safety, financial, and legal vulnerabilities
- Developing risk mitigation and response plans
- Supporting compliance with Australian workplace regulations
- Advising on insurance coverage and claims preparedness
- Assisting with business continuity and disaster recovery planning
Why risk management matters for Australian businesses.
In today’s competitive environment, risk is unavoidable, but poor preparation is not an option. Australian risk management consultants help businesses stay ahead of challenges such as:
- Extreme weather events affecting operations and supply chains
- Workplace safety incidents and liability exposure
- Cybersecurity threats and data breaches
- Regulatory changes across industries
- Financial volatility and market disruptions
By proactively addressing these risks, businesses can protect assets, employees, and reputation.

Industries that benefit most.
While all businesses can gain value, certain sectors in Australia rely heavily on structured risk management:
- Construction and engineering
- Mining and resources
- Agriculture and primary production
- Healthcare and aged care
- Financial services and insurance
- Transport and logistics
Each industry faces unique risks that require specialised expertise and tailored solutions.
How to choose the right consultant.
Selecting the right risk management consultant is essential for achieving real results.
Consider:
- Industry experience relevant to your business sector
- Understanding of Australian compliance standards
- Proven track record in risk mitigation projects
- Clear communication and practical recommendations
- Ability to integrate with existing business systems
A strong consultant does not just identify problems, they help you build long-term resilience.
